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How often should I have my window locks inspected?
It is suggested to inspect window locks at least yearly, specifically if you live in a high-crime area or your locks are older. Routine upkeep guarantees they work correctly.
2. Can I set up window locks myself?
While some house owners may feel positive in setting up window locks, working with an expert service technician is recommended to make sure appropriate installation and functionality.

3. What kinds of window locks are readily available?
There are numerous types of window locks, consisting of:
- Single and double hung window locks
- Sliding window locks
- Sash window locks
- Window sash locks
- Enhanced locks with deadbolts
4. How do I know if my window locks require replacing?
Signs that locks might need changing consist of:
- Difficulty in locking/unlocking
- Visible wear and tear
- Rust or rust
- If the lock mechanism feels loose or unsteady
